In the presence of poetry – a conversation piece by Fiona Owen and Victoria Field
Journal of Poetry Therapy Pub Date : 2019-06-12 , DOI: 10.1080/08893675.2019.1625158
Fiona Owen 1 , Victoria Field 2
Affiliation  

ABSTRACT Victoria Field, writer, CPT/CAPF and International Fellow at the England Centre for Practice Development, Canterbury Christ Church University, UK and Fiona Owen, writer, Associate Lecturer at the Open University in Wales and tutor of Eye of the Storm writing courses, dialogue on the question of what happens when we are “in the presence” of a poem that moves us in some way. Using two examples of contemporary poems, they explore both how the imagery overlaps in these poems and reflect on personal resonances and associations.
